Generative Synthetic Intelligence (GenAI) instruments like ChatGPT, GitHub Copilot, Cursor, Devin, and so on. are quickly altering the position of software program engineers by altering the way in which we code.
All people on the earth is now a programmer — Nvidia’s CEO Jensen Huang [1]
McKinsey estimates that software program engineering is likely one of the enterprise features that will probably be most impacted by GenAI. They estimate a 30% improve in productiveness for software program engineers utilizing generative AI instruments [2].
In case you are a software program engineer / software program developer, you will need to adapt to this new know-how now or danger being left behind.
In keeping with Gartner, GenAI would require 80% of the engineering workforce to upskill by 2027 [3].
I just lately accomplished DeepLearning.AI’s specialization course Generative AI for Software program Growth.
Primarily based on this on-line course, I’ll go over the most effective practices of working with a Massive Language Mannequin (LLM) as a coding assistant with examples in Python.